From e64d0757036ab6d1b1c5f5c72ab052dfc2c7bf1c Mon Sep 17 00:00:00 2001 From: Moritz Gmeiner Date: Sun, 10 Sep 2023 14:36:26 +0200 Subject: [PATCH] rust thin lto; gmp without cpudetection --- make.conf/00common | 2 +- package.use/gmp |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) create mode 100644 package.use/gmp diff --git a/make.conf/00common b/make.conf/00common index c70d8d1..f87c2ac 100644 --- a/make.conf/00common +++ b/make.conf/00common @@ -6,7 +6,7 @@ CXXFLAGS="${COMMON_FLAGS}" FCFLAGS="${COMMON_FLAGS}" FFLAGS="${COMMON_FLAGS}" -RUSTFLAGS="-C target-cpu=native -C opt-level=3 -C linker=clang -C link-arg=-fuse-ld=mold" +RUSTFLAGS="-C target-cpu=native -C opt-level=3 -C lto=thin -C linker=clang -C link-arg=-fuse-ld=mold" CC="clang" CXX="clang++" diff --git a/package.use/gmp b/package.use/gmp new file mode 100644 index 0000000..99cd08e --- /dev/null +++ b/package.use/gmp @@ -0,0 +1 @@ +dev-libs/gmp -cpudetection